Transaction 71f85fae23cab8fc615184fa121cb4d030bf4fde1fc879f4b9ddf9c24599275b

1 Input
2 Outputs
  • 71f85fae23cab8fc615184fa121cb4d030bf4fde1fc879f4b9ddf9c24599275b:0
  • value  1380000
    address  3PRovHKTsGGFTC4qqRSjqYSgJR5mCPPKtt
  • 71f85fae23cab8fc615184fa121cb4d030bf4fde1fc879f4b9ddf9c24599275b:1
  • value  422913548
    address  3875fEYS9KLYQkEkoXv8fD4i5fmUUMzuDW